I am bookmarking this one ... I end up with lots of half square triangle blocks because whenever I am doing those pieces where you draw a line across the diagonal to take the corner off a square? or rectangle?
I move over 1/2" and stitch a second seam, cut down the middle ... I get the piece I really wanted and a bonus HST ... when you make a complete laprobe, you can end up with a LOT of them.
